> > +config MFD_MT6370
> > +       tristate "Mediatek MT6370 SubPMIC"
> > +       select MFD_CORE
> > +       select REGMAP_I2C
> > +       select REGMAP_IRQ
> > +       depends on I2C
> > +       help
> > +         Say Y here to enable MT6370 SubPMIC functional support.
> > +         It consists of a single cell battery charger with ADC monitoring, RGB
> > +         LEDs, dual channel flashlight, WLED backlight driver, display bias
> > +         voltage supply, one general purpose LDO, and the USB Type-C & PD
> > +         controller complies with the latest USB Type-C and PD standards.

> > +#define MT6370_REG_MAXADDR     0x1FF
>
> Wondering if (BIT(10) - 1) gives a better hint on how hardware limits
> this (so it will be clear it's 10-bit address).

well... This "0x1FF" is just a virtual mapping value to map the max
address of the PMU bank(0x1XX).
So, I feel its means is different from using (BIT(10) - 1) here.
